WebJul 23, 2024 · How to Delete Pages in the WordPress Dashboard Administrator Area. Log in to the WordPress Dashboard. In the menu at left, click on All Pages. Find the page or pages that you want to delete. If you are deleting multiple pages, click on the checkbox for each page. If you are deleting a single page, then hover over the title of the page. WebFeb 9, 2024 · WordPress Revision History is a handy feature that allows you to revert changes to your posts and pages by restoring an earlier version of a post or page. If you ever accidentally deleted a part of your post or if you lost your Internet connection due to a power outage, it saves you from writing the entire post from scratch. WebGo to Pages in your dashboard. Find the page About and click the title. Locate the Page Attributes module to the right of the editor. Put the number 1 in the box for Order. This tells WordPress to display this page first on your site. Click the Update button. Repeat the process for your other pages, but use higher numbers for the Order field: 2 ... WebFeb 4, 2024 · Pick a page for which you want to change the order. Click on “ QuickEdit ” under the page title. Enter any number in the Order field. Click on the blue “ Update ” button. The numbers you enter in the Order field determine on which position the WordPress page should be displayed. You can easily change the page order in the backend.
